Easingwold Fun Day and Brass Band Competition

26th June 2010

The Easingwold Fun Day is on June 26th and promises to be the best ever! Held in the historic Easingwold Market Square surrounded by lovely Georgian buildings, the event is definitely not to be missed if you are anywhere in the area!

First event of the day are the Easingwold Fun Runs, organised by and in aid of our local Scouts, they traditionally attract a large number of younsters and adults alike. With distances of 1.5 miles, 3 miles and a 6 mile quarter marathon, there is something for everyone. Go on, have a go!

Entries are available on the day at the Easingwold Scout hut up to 12:00. Races start at 1:00pm and all start and finish in the Market square - and everyone receives a here's welcome! Folowing the races, there will be a large number of events organised by the Easingwold Lions in the market square including tombola, raffles, stalls selling everything you could imagine and more, rides for children, Punch and Judy etc. food and crafts etc. All the things that make up a traditional Town Fair in fact! In the afternoon there will be a performance by a group of dancers - last years cheerleaders group were fabulous as they performed with real panash!

 

After things quieten down at tea time, the Market Square starts to fill up and the marching bands begin to tune their instruments. The band contest is actually the second oldest in the country and attracts a high level of skill from bands over a wide area. Each band marches around the Market square in uniform and playing a piece of music.  Boys & girls from the local Scouts & Guides lead each band around the square

Competition is keen in the band contests!

They are all assessed on their playing, but also their appearance and marching style.All in all, the very best day in Easingwold's calender. Do not miss it whatever you do!
